Dick Gregory was such a ****ing pioneer. Dude is up there with Lenny Bruce.

Jerry Lewis was really funny early on with Dean Martin. He just fell back on the same bits to the point of completely wearing them out.

And ya, he'd get weepy after being up and broadcasting for over 20 hours. His telethons raised nearly $2.5 billion through the years so he deserves credit for that.
